Inside Meghan Markle & Prince Harry’s £11million California home with 16 bedrooms & a pool

MEGHAN MARKLE and Prince Harry live in a gorgeous California home. What kind of features does it have?
Daily Express :: Life and Style Feed

LEAVE A REPLY

Please enter your comment!
Please enter your name here